Мне нужно подгруппировать данные по дате, чтобы показывать только первый квартал года - PullRequest
0 голосов
/ 20 сентября 2019

Я пытаюсь разместить данные по дате, чтобы получить результаты только за первый квартал года.

# Мой фрейм данных

        > ewport[c(1:3,nrow(ewport)),]
               date   AMZN    IBM
       1   2012-12-31 1.0232 1.0091
       2   2013-01-02 1.0257 1.0251
       3   2013-01-03 1.0045 0.9945
       253 2013-12-31 1.0138 1.0062

Попытка поднабора по дате

     ew.q1 <- subset(ewport,
       +                 ewport$date >= as.Date("2012-12-31") & 
       +                   ewport$date <= as.Date("2012-03-31"))
             > ew.q1[c(1:3,nrow(ew.q1)),]
                    date AMZN IBM
               NA   <NA>   NA  NA
               NA.1 <NA>   NA  NA
               NA.2 <NA>   NA  NA
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...